QP CODE : 1021

Rajiv Gandhi University of Health Sciences, Karnataka

MBBS Phase – I (CBME) Degree Examination - 24-Feb-2022

--- Content provided by FirstRanker.com ---

Time: Three Hours Max. Marks: 100 Marks

ANATOMY – PAPER - II (RS-4)

Q.P. CODE: 1021

(QP contains three pages)

Your answers should be specific to the questions asked

--- Content provided by⁠ FirstRanker.com ---

Draw neat, labeled diagrams wherever necessary

LONG ESSAYS 2 x 10 = 20 Marks

  1. Describe the inguinal canal under the following headings

    1. Boundaries
    2. Contents
    3. --- Content provided by FirstRanker.com ---

    4. Mechanism to maintain the integrity of inguinal canal
    5. Applied anatomy
  2. A 60 year old female complains of pain in the back of right thigh radiating to the sole. She is diagnosed with sciatica.

    1. Mention the anatomical basis of sciatica.
    2. --- Content provided by FirstRanker.com ---

    3. Describe course, relations and branches of sciatic nerve.

SHORT ESSAYS 8 x 5 = 40 Marks

  1. Describe the microscopic structure of ovary with a neat labelled diagram.
  2. Describe the boundaries and contents of Ischiorectral fossa.
  3. --- Content provided by‍ FirstRanker.com ---

  4. Describe the process of midgut rotation. Add a note on associated anomalies.
  5. Describe the relations of Liver.
  6. Enumerate the sites of portocaval anastomosis. Explain the anatomical basis for hematemesis and caput medusae in portal hypertension
  7. Describe indications, process and disadvantages of Amniocentesis
  8. Describe the supports of uterus and its clinical significance.
  9. --- Content provided by‍ FirstRanker.com ---

  10. Describe the presenting parts, relations and nerve supply of Urinary bladder

SHORT ANSWERS 10 x 3 = 30 Marks

  1. Mention the derivatives of ventral and dorsal pancreatic bud
  2. Enumerate the posterior relations of the kidney
  3. List the structures present at transpyloric plane
  4. --- Content provided by FirstRanker.com ---

  5. Compare and contrast the microscopic features of ureter and vas deferens
  6. Mention the formation of femoral sheath. Enumerate its contents
  7. List the muscles causing Inversion and eversion
  8. Name the boundaries of epiploic foramen
  9. Explain the clinical Importance of Recto-uterine pouch
  10. --- Content provided by‌ FirstRanker.com ---

  11. Enumerate the contents of superficial perineal pouch
  12. Draw a neat labelled diagram of microscopic structure of fundus of stomach

Multiple Choice Questions 10 x 1 = 10 Marks
